First published in 1814, this book offers a collection of rules and descriptions for a variety of card games and other diversions popular in eighteenth-century England. The author, Edmond Hoyle, was a renowned game expert and his work set the standard for many of the games played today. This book is an excellent choice for anyone interested in the history of gaming or looking to learn more about traditional card games.
